The S&P 500 gained 2.7%, it’s best day since August 2015. It’s nice to see some green after a lot of red last week, but big up days don’t usually occur in healthy markets. Going back to 1970, 74% of the +2.5% days happened under the 200-day moving average. 76% of them happened when the market was already in a 10% drawdown. In other words, the best days tend to be snap backs like we saw today.
Buying panics are pretty rare. You typically don’t see big up days in healthy markets because buyers don’t capitulate all at once the way that sellers do. Of the 169 different +2.5% days since 1970, only five occurred within 1% of an all-time high: November 1980, February 1991, August 1991, February 1999, and March 21 2000 (three days before the top).
